Output 3df6a029d62ece292518fbd7be166a4b5f017583cdee3b11d9188c49d19d23ea:21

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a03a5468bc59fa99a6eb5f39aa03f53c7526818 OP_EQUAL
address
9topbgK3Zi3Tbvai2HYtGKXQetcaDfFenr
transaction
3df6a029d62ece292518fbd7be166a4b5f017583cdee3b11d9188c49d19d23ea